Key Features
The Grain Drum Pendant from Ravenhill Studio offers a refined and organic style. A fabricator in L.A. told the brand that traces of wood grain from the metal-spinning tool could be seen in the finished parts. Leaning into this, a pattern maker helped create custum molds from maple boards, sandblasted to raise the wood grain. The molds are then spun on a lathe at the same speed as a sheet of aluminum, forming around the mold to add the grain pattern to the pendant's shade. The result is a contemporary and comforting appearance that fits most settings.

A measurement of the power delivered to a component of an electric circuit (allowing a one-ampere current to flow through the component under the pressure of 1 volt.)Bulb Shape
Bulb shapes are denoted with a letter, which describes the shape, and a number, which indicates the size. The number indicates the diameter of the light bulb at its widest part in eighths of an inch.Base
The part of the bulb that connects to the fixture and its power supply. Bulb bases are denoted with the letter E, and a number which indicates the diameter of the bulb base at its widest part in millimeters.Voltage
